How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Turtletown?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Turtletown Studio Apartments | $985 | $825 | $1,866 |
| Turtletown 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,299 | $595 | $3,000 |
| Turtletown 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,510 | $745 | $3,044 |
| Turtletown 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,812 | $890 | $4,570 |
| Turtletown 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,835 | $1,319 | $1,900 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Turtletown Apartments with Hardwood Floors
What is the Cheapest Hardwood Floors apartment in Turtletown?
Currently the most affordable Apartment in Turtletown with Hardwood Floors is at The Charlie listed at $999.
How much is the average rent for Turtletown Apartments with Hardwood Floors?
The average rent for a Apartment in Turtletown with Hardwood Floors is $1,898.
What is the largest Turtletown Apartment for rent with Hardwood Floors?
Today's Apartment with Hardwood Floors and the most square footage in Turtletown is a 1,466 square feet unit starting from $1,340 at The Village at Apison Pike.
What is the average size for Turtletown Apartments for rent with Hardwood Floors?
The average size for a rental with Hardwood Floors in Turtletown is currently at 768 sq ft.
